1. Oracle :
Oracle is an American multinational computer technology corporation headquartered in California united states founded by Larry Ellison Bob Oates 1977. Oracle is a relational management system. It is the first database designed for grid computing that provides the most flexible and cost-effective way to manage information and application. It runs a major platform like WINDOW, UNIX, LINUX and MACOS. It will relational database in which data accessed by the user through the application or query language called SQL.
Here is Different Edition of oracle are:
- Enterprise Edition
- Standard Edition
- Express Edition
- Oracle Edition
2. PostgreSQL :
PostgreSQL is a relational database management system. It is an open-source database active development for over 20 years. It supports all the features of RDBMS that provide open connectivity and runs on major platforms like UNIX, MACOS, WINDOW, LINUX etc. It also supports video text audio images programming interface in various programming language C, C++, JAVA, PYTHON, PERL etc. It also knows as POSTGRES.
Difference between Oracle and PostgreSQL :
|Definition||Oracle is a relational management system.It is first database designed for grid computing.||PostgreSQL is free open source relational-database management system emphasizing extensibility and SQL compliance.|
|Development||Oracle developed by Larry Ellison and Bob in 16 june 1977.||PostgreSQL developed by PostgreSQL global Development group in 8 july 1996.|
|Written in||Oracle written in c and C++ language.||PostgreSQL written in C language.|
|Latest version||Oracle runs on 19c version which release on February 2019.||PostgreSQL runs on PostgreSQL 12.3 version which release on may 2020.|
|License||Oracle required license.||PostgreSQL is open source.|
|Support||Oracle support cost based.||PostgreSQL provide free support or option with paid support at low cost.|
|Security||Oracle is more secure than PostgreSQL.||PostgreSQL provide good security but it is not secure as Oracle.|
|Programming language||Oracle support various language like C, C++, JAVA, PERL, .NET, JAVA SCRIPT, PHP etc.||PostgreSQL support C, C++, JAVA, PERL, SCALA, PHP, C#, COBOL, JAVA SCRIPT etc.|
|Features.||Availability. Fast-Start Failover to Standby Database.
Business Intelligence. SQL Support for Analytic Applications.
Clustering. Real Application Clusters (RAC) Performance.
|Complex SQL queries.
Multi version concurrency control (MVCC)
Attention reader! Don’t stop learning now. Get hold of all the important CS Theory concepts for SDE interviews with the CS Theory Course at a student-friendly price and become industry ready.
- Difference between Oracle NoSQL and Oracle
- Difference between Oracle and MongoDB
- Difference between Impala and Oracle
- Difference between Hive and Oracle
- Difference between Oracle and Cassandra
- Difference between Oracle and Couchbase
- Difference between Oracle and CouchDB
- Difference between Oracle and MariaDB
- Difference between Oracle and MySQL
- Difference between Oracle and Firebase
- Difference between Oracle and Derby
- Difference between Oracle and dBASE
- Difference between Oracle and PouchDB
- Difference between PouchDB and PostgreSQL
- Difference between MySQL and PostgreSQL
- Difference between PostgreSQL and MongoDB
- Difference between MariaDB and PostgreSQL
- Difference between SQLite and PostgreSQL
- Difference between Couchbase and PostgreSQL
- Difference between CouchDB and PostgreSQL
If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to firstname.lastname@example.org. See your article appearing on the GeeksforGeeks main page and help other Geeks.
Please Improve this article if you find anything incorrect by clicking on the "Improve Article" button below.